Looking at Painting in Florence 13th-16th Centuries: a Learner's Handbook

There?s been a time when, during their Grand Tour, learned amateurs coming from distant countries, after contemplating the masterpieces of the Florentine galleries, conveyed in their letters to relatives and friends outmost admiration, but also relevant and insightful remarks. This time seems to live again in the work of Richard Peterson, a cultivated American ?amateur?, who with devotion, but also with objectivity and competence, introduces us to the wonders of Medieval and Renaissance art in a volume, rich in beautiful pictures in color, which is more of a guide, a travel companion which to appeal to under the emotional impact of masterpieces of superhuman beauty, an enjoyable antidote to Stendhal?s syndrome that, exorcised our vertigo in front of immortal works, illustrates in plain, familiar language their meaning, novelty, magnificence. We follow Richard Peterson, reading his descriptions interspersed with illuminating historical sketches, in Santa Croce, the Brancacci Chapel at the Carmine, the Uffizi, Santa Maria Novella and San Marco, in the Accademia and along other great Florentine artistic repositories. This book imparts the skills that allow the reader to answer the question ?Why does this painting matter?? Devoted solely to the entire course of Florentine painting, from the Middle Ages through the Renaissance, this richly illustrated handbook is intended to bridge the gap between the guidebook and the serious academic text. The book is organized chronologically around the churches and cloisters, the principal museums and palaces that house the city?s art.
